Estou tentando unir duas interfaces, ambas em um único cartão de expansão, em uma única interface. Eu fiz isso em versões anteriores com pouco ou nenhum problema.
No entanto, em 18.04, uma das interfaces não está aparecendo em ifconfig
e ip link
informa isso como desativado na inicialização.
dmesg
da seguinte forma:
dmesg | grep enp3s0
[ 1.300680] r8169 0000:03:00.0 enp3s0: renamed from eth0
[ 4.922220] r8169 0000:03:00.0 enp3s0: link down
[ 4.922235] r8169 0000:03:00.0 enp3s0: link down
[ 4.922774] bond0: the hw address of slave enp3s0 is in use by the bond; couldn't find a slave with a free hw address to give it (this should not have happened)
Configuração:
network:
ethernets:
enp3s0:
dhcp4: false
enp4s0:
dhcp4: false
version: 2
bonds:
bond0:
interfaces: [enp3s0,enp4s0]
addresses: [192.168.1.10/24]
gateway4: 192.168.1.2
mtu: 9000
nameservers:
addresses: [192.168.1.2, 8.8.8.8]
search: [foo]
parameters:
mode: balance-alb
ip link
mostra as duas interfaces com o mesmo MAC. Eu sei que isso é possível a partir de 16.04, como faço para que ele funcione com o netplan?